Basketball Recap: Burroughs Bears vs. Bishop Alemany Warriors
Burroughs won the last time they faced Bishop Alemany and things went their way on Saturday too. The Burroughs Bears came out on top against the Bishop Alemany Warriors by a score of 63-50. Given the Bears' advantage in MaxPreps' California basketball rankings (they are ranked 155th, while the Warriors are ranked 390th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.

Burroughs was led to victory by Mariam Fahs and Valentina Morales. Fahs dropped a double-double on 15 points and 13 boards, while Morales dropped a double-double on 17 points and 13 boards. The dominant performance gave Fahs a new career-high in rebounds. The team also got some help courtesy of Jessica Mena, who posted eight points and five assists.
The win was the fourth in a row for Burroughs, bringing their record for this year to 12-6.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 58.8 points per game. As for Bishop Alemany, they moved to 7-10 with that defeat, which also ended their three-game winning streak.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Burroughs will take on Crescenta Valley at 5:15 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Bishop Alemany, they will face off against Marymount at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
